#e0c720 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e0c720 is composed of 87.8% red, 78%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11.2% magenta, 85.7%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 52.2 degrees, a saturation of 75.6% and a lightness of 50.2%. #e0c720 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ff40 with #c18f00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

Shades and Tints of #e0c720

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#fdfbef is the lightest one.

Tones of #e0c720

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#888678 is the less saturated color, while #fddd03 is the most saturated one.
